If we are changing the LLP agreement means, is it enough to get signature only from designated partners or it is required to get signature from all the partners in Supplymental deed. Or

Is there is any specific reason where only DP'S are enough sign or whenever we are changing the LLP AGREEMENT all the partners are required to sign.

The initial agreement is to be signed by all the partners of the llp.

ln the same vein all the Partners shall sign the Supplementary deed as well. 

This is because the partnership has been entered into with consent of all parties with their signature appended to it. So any change to the deed will require their signature as well.
